The Yokogawa AQ2200-421 is an optical switch module for the AQ2200 Multi Application Test System, engineered to automate optical signal switching in demanding test environments. It enables rapid, repeatable switching of optical signals across multiple signal paths, eliminating manual intervention and improving measurement reliability. Designed for manufacturing, R&D, and quality control workflows, the module integrates directly into the AQ2200 chassis for fully automated optical device characterization and system verification.

– Compatibility & Integration
The AQ2200-421 is exclusively designed for the Yokogawa AQ2200 Multi Application Test System platform. It operates under chassis-level control, requiring no external control electronics or standalone power supplies. The module occupies a dedicated slot within the AQ2200 mainframe and communicates through the internal chassis interface for command execution and status monitoring.
